The Mechanical Engineer will p erform engineering duties in planning, analyzing and designing mechanical equipment and systems. Oversee installation, operation, testing, maintenance, and repair of such equipment.
RESPONSIBILITIES :
- Research and analyze customer design proposals, specifications, manuals, and other data to evaluate the feasibility, cost, and maintenance requirements of designs or applications.
- Confer with engineers and other personnel to implement operating procedures, resolve system malfunctions, and provide technical information.
- Specify system components or direct modification of products to ensure conformance with engineering design and performance specifications.
- Research, design, evaluate, install, operate, and maintain mechanical products, equipment, systems and processes to meet requirements, applying knowledge of engineering principles.
- Investigate equipment failures and difficulties to diagnose faulty operation, and to make recommendations to address issues.
- Provide designs using drafting tools or computer-assisted design / drafting equipment and software.
- Recommend design modifications to eliminate machine or system malfunctions.
- Develop and test models of alternate designs and processing methods to assess feasibility, operating condition effects, possible new applications and necessity of modification.
- Estimate costs and submit bids for engineering, construction, or extraction projects, and prepare contract
- Establish and coordinate the maintenance and safety procedures, service schedule, and supply of materials required to maintain machines and equipment in the prescribed condition.
- Study industrial processes to determine where and how application of equipment can be made.
- Write performance requirements for product development or engineering projects.
- Design test control apparatus and equipment and develop procedures for testing products. Provide onsite support for such testing both onshore and offshore.
